India's eight core industries, have a combined weight of 38% in the Index of Industrial Production (IIP), witnessed a growth of 6.3% in October, 2014 from 1.9% growth in the last month. Its cumulative growth during April to October, 2014-15 was 4.3%.
Coal production increased by 16.2% in October, 2014 over October, 2013. Its cumulative index during April to October, 2014-15 increased by 8.5 % over corresponding period of previous year.
Crude Oil production increased by 1% in October, 2014 over October, 2013. The cumulative index of Crude Oil during April to October, 2014-15 declined by 0.9 % over the corresponding period of previous year.
The Natural Gas production declined by 4.2% in October, 2014 over October, 2013. Its cumulative index during April to October, 2014-15 declined by 5.6 % over the corresponding period of previous year.
Petroleum refinery production increased by 4.2% in October, 2014 over October, 2013. Its cumulative index during April to October, 2014-15 declined by 1.7% over the corresponding period of previous year.
Fertilizer production declined by 7% in October, 2014 over October, 2013. Its cumulative index during April to October, 2014-15 declined by 1.1 % over the corresponding period of previous year.
Steel production increased by 2.3% in October, 2014 over October, 2013. Its cumulative index during April to October, 2014-15 also increased by 2.3 % over the corresponding period of previous year.
Cement production declined by 1% in October, 2014 over October, 2013. Its cumulative growth during April to October, 2014-15 was 8.1 % over the corresponding period of previous year.
Electricity generation increased by 13.2% in October, 2014 over the period of October, 2013 and it registered a cumulative growth of 10.5% during April to October, 2014-15 over the corresponding period of previous year.
